( Informational Workshops for the Medicaid Discount Cards Date: July 27,2004 Subject: The Neighborhood Services Department, Office of Community Services is collaborating with the Florida Department of Elder Affairs and the Alliance for Aging, Inc. to present a series of public workshops to promote use of the Medicare-approved Prescription Drug Discount Cards in our community. The workshops will be held in the Commission Chambers on August 2, 2004 and will be presented in English and Spanish in the following schedule: Session Time 9:30am 11 :30am 2:30 m 4:30 m The Medicare-approved Prescription Drug Discount Cards are intended to be a resource for elder and disabled residents of Florida with Medicare coverage who are not enrolled in a health maintenance organization (HMO), The card lowers the cost of prescription medications. The Florida Department of Elder Affairs and the Alliance for the Aging, Inc., the area agency on aging for Miami-Dade and Monroe counties, collaboratively support the Serving Health Insurance Needs of Elders (SHINE) program to educate the community on health-care options including prescription medication coverage. The focus of these workshops will be the Prescription Drug Discount Card and Transitional Assistance Program. This initiative provides seniors and persons with disabilities with a savings of 10 to 25 percent on prescriptions drugs. Low-income beneficiaries may also be eligible for an additional $600 transitional credit. Currently, Florida consumers have more than two dozen discount cards to select from with an additional 1 0 options through managed care plan "exclusive cards." There is also a public hearing scheduled for Wednesday, August 4, 2004, from 11 :00 a.m. to 1 :00 p.m. in the Commission Chambers being held by the Alliance for Aging to obtain seniors' needs and input on experiences with service delivery to develop a three-year plan. The Alliance for Aging is responsible for the majority of funding for agencies that provide elder services. The workshops and the hearing are free and of interest to any senior citizen, person caring for an elder, or a family member of a senior on Medicare. The Medicare workshops will take place on Monday, August 2, 2004 with the English sessions at 9:30 a.m. and 2:30 p.m. and the Spanish sessions at 11:30 a.m. and 4:30 p.m. The public hearing on elderly services will be held on Wednesday, August 4, 2004 from 11:00 a.m. to 1:00 p.m. The hearing will be held in English, Spanish and Russian. The workshops and hearing will all be held at Miami Beach City Hall, Commission Chambers, third floor, located at 1700 Convention Center Drive, Miami Beach. The open workshops will answer questions about the changes in Medicare policies, and welcome suggestions, inquiries or problems with any resident's current situation with Medicare. A speaker from SHINE (Serving Health Insurance Needs of Elders), funded by the Department of Elder Affairs, will encourage discussions from seniors about delivery problems, needs, and priorities for service delivery. Residents with HMO insurance coverage and without are also welcome. Senior residents of 60+ years of age in the Miami-Dade and Monroe counties should attend to learn more about their healthcare. The public hearing is held by the Alliance for Aging to obtain seniors' needs and input on experiences with service delivery to develop a three-year plan. The Alliance for Aging is responsible for the majority of funding for agencies that provide elder services. Florida law requires that a plan for the elderly is made every three years and the planning for the 2005-2007 plan is already in the process.
